10% Better Acceleration in Snow. Primacy? Alpin® PA3? tires offer a 10% gain in acceleration and handling characteristics in snow as a result of more sipe edges biting into snow and ice from 3-D StabiliGrip Technology? with its bi-directional auto blocking and variable geometry sipes. (Based on Michelin internal snow traction test results for Michelin® Pilot® Alpin® PA2? tires.)
Get Shorter, Safer Stops. Increased traction at low temperatures for improved braking and handling in the wet and better over-all performance in the snow, all the result of the revolutionary Helio Compound?, with sunflower oil. The Primacy? Alpin® PA3? tire stops 5.6 feet shorter than its predecessor on wet. (Based on Michelin internal snow traction tests results for Michelin® Pilot® Alpin® PA2? tires.)
Get More Miles for Your Money. Building on the fuel efficiencies of its predecessor, the Primacy? Alpin® PA3? tire uses even less fuel thanks to a rolling resistance that has been reduced by 7%. (Comparisons based upon fuel efficiency testing between Michelin® Primacy? Alpin® PA3? tires versus Michelin® Pilot® Alpin® PA2? tires. Fuel Savings are estimates based on comparative rolling resistance. Actual on-road savings may vary.)
